Centos(GNOME)下的压缩软件--Archive Manager

如果需要在GNOME界面的右键菜单中出现“压缩”(“解压”)功能,则需要安装归档管理器(Archive Manager).

可以用系统(菜单),管理,添加/删除程序来安装,在里面搜索:"File roller"(奇怪为什么不是Archive Manager?)

也可以用命令:

yum install file-roller

<think>好的,我现在需要帮助用户在CentOS 7上安装KDevelop 4.3桌面版。首先,我得确认KDevelop 4.3的可用性以及CentOS 7的软件仓库是否包含这个版本。CentOS 7的默认仓库可能比较旧,可能没有KDevelop 4.3,或者版本较低。需要检查EPEL仓库或其他第三方仓库是否有提供。 用户提到的KDevelop 4.3是较旧的版本,可能对应的KDE版本也比较旧。CentOS 7默认的KDE可能不够新,可能需要添加额外的仓库,比如EPEL或者KDE官方仓库。不过,EPEL可能提供较新的软件包,但需要确认是否包含KDevelop 4.3。另外,用户可能需要从源代码编译安装,但这对于普通用户来说可能比较复杂。 首先,建议用户启用EPEL仓库,因为这是常见的扩展包来源。安装EPEL后,查看是否有kdevelop的包。命令可能是yum install kdevelop,但版本可能不是4.3。如果EPEL中没有,可能需要添加其他仓库,比如KDE的仓库或者第三方如Remi仓库。 另外,CentOS 7的软件包管理工具是yum,使用rpm包。可能需要下载KDevelop 4.3的rpm包手动安装,但要处理依赖关系,这可能比较麻烦。如果存在依赖问题,可能需要逐个安装依赖包,或者寻找包含这些依赖的仓库。 另一种方法是使用源代码编译安装。需要从KDevelop的官方网站下载源代码,然后按照编译步骤进行。但编译需要安装开发工具和依赖库,比如KDE开发库、CMake、gcc等。这可能需要用户有一定的经验,步骤可能包括: 1. 安装开发工具组:sudo yum groupinstall "Development Tools" 2. 安装必要的依赖库,如Qt、KDE库等。 3. 下载KDevelop 4.3源码。 4. 解压并进入目录,运行CMake配置,然后make和make install。 但这种方法可能遇到依赖问题,尤其是旧版本的库在CentOS 7中可能已经更新或被废弃,导致编译失败。需要确保所有依赖库的版本与KDevelop 4.3兼容。 用户可能需要权衡是否必须使用4.3版本,如果更高版本可用,可能更容易安装。如果必须使用特定版本,可能需要寻找旧的仓库或第三方提供的rpm包。 另外,KDevelop作为KDE的一部分,可能需要KDE桌面环境,但用户可能使用的是GNOME或其他桌面环境。不过,KDevelop应该可以在其他桌面环境中运行,但可能需要安装KDE的运行时库。 总结可能的步骤: 1. 启用EPEL仓库:sudo yum install epel-release 2. 查找kdevelop包:yum search kdevelop 3. 如果找到正确版本,直接安装;否则,考虑其他方法。 4. 如果使用源代码,安装依赖项,下载源码,编译安装。 5. 处理可能的依赖问题,可能需要添加其他仓库或手动安装依赖包。 还需要提醒用户注意兼容性和维护问题,旧版本可能不再支持或有安全风险。如果用户有特定需求需要4.3版本,可能需要更详细的指导,比如找到可用的仓库或源码。</think>### 在 CentOS 7 上安装 KDevelop 4.3 桌面版的步骤 #### 1. 添加 EPEL 仓库和额外依赖 EPEL(Extra Packages for Enterprise Linux)仓库包含额外的软件包,可能提供所需依赖: ```bash sudo yum install epel-release sudo yum update ``` #### 2. 安装 KDE 桌面环境(可选) 若系统未安装 KDE 桌面,需先安装 KDE 基础组件: ```bash sudo yum groupinstall "KDE Plasma Workspaces" ``` #### 3. 启用 KDE 附加仓库 通过 **kde-redhat** 仓库获取更多 KDE 软件包: ```bash sudo yum install https://download-ib01.fedoraproject.org/pub/epel/7/x86_64/Packages/k/kde-redhat-archive-keyring-20170904-1.el7.noarch.rpm sudo yum-config-manager --add-repo=https://download-ib01.fedoraproject.org/pub/epel/7/kmods/kde/ ``` #### 4. 安装 KDevelop 4.3 执行以下命令安装: ```bash sudo yum install kdevelop ``` 若默认仓库版本不符,可尝试指定旧版本: ```bash sudo yum install kdevelop-4.3.0 ``` #### 5. 手动编译安装(备用方案) 若仓库版本不匹配,需从源码编译: ```bash # 安装编译工具和依赖 sudo yum install gcc-c++ cmake automake qt-devel kdelibs-devel # 下载源码 wget https://download.kde.org/stable/kdevelop/4.3.0/src/kdevelop-4.3.0.tar.xz tar -xvf kdevelop-4.3.0.tar.xz cd kdevelop-4.3.0 # 编译安装 mkdir build && cd build cmake .. -DCMAKE_INSTALL_PREFIX=/usr make -j$(nproc) sudo make install ``` #### 6. 验证安装 终端输入 `kdevelop` 或通过应用菜单启动。若提示依赖缺失,可使用 `sudo yum provides [缺失文件]` 定位依赖包。 ---
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值